如何在全链路数据质量监控中识别数据偏差?

在当今数据驱动的时代,数据质量对于企业的决策至关重要。然而,数据偏差的存在可能导致错误的决策和业务损失。全链路数据质量监控是确保数据准确性和可靠性的关键环节。本文将深入探讨如何在全链路数据质量监控中识别数据偏差,并分析如何通过有效的监控手段来提高数据质量。

一、数据偏差的类型

  1. 数据缺失:数据缺失是指数据集中某些字段或记录缺少信息。数据缺失可能导致分析结果偏差,影响决策的准确性。

  2. 数据错误:数据错误是指数据中存在不准确、不合理或异常的值。数据错误可能源于数据录入、传输或处理过程中的错误。

  3. 数据不一致:数据不一致是指同一数据在不同系统或数据库中存在差异。数据不一致可能导致信息孤岛,影响数据整合和分析。

  4. 数据重复:数据重复是指数据集中存在重复的记录或字段。数据重复可能源于数据录入或传输过程中的错误。

二、全链路数据质量监控的步骤

  1. 数据采集:在数据采集阶段,应确保数据来源的可靠性和准确性。可以通过与数据提供方建立良好的沟通机制,确保数据采集过程的规范。

  2. 数据清洗:数据清洗是数据预处理的重要环节,旨在识别和纠正数据中的错误、缺失和重复。数据清洗方法包括数据填充、数据替换、数据合并等。

  3. 数据转换:数据转换是指将原始数据转换为适合分析的形式。在数据转换过程中,应关注数据类型、格式和编码等问题。

  4. 数据存储:数据存储阶段,应确保数据存储的安全性、可靠性和可扩展性。选择合适的数据库和存储方案,以支持数据分析和查询。

  5. 数据分析:数据分析阶段,通过对数据进行分析,识别数据偏差。数据分析方法包括统计分析、数据挖掘和机器学习等。

  6. 数据监控:数据监控是全链路数据质量监控的核心环节。通过实时监控数据质量,及时发现并处理数据偏差。

三、识别数据偏差的方法

  1. 数据可视化:通过数据可视化工具,将数据以图表、图形等形式展示,便于直观地识别数据偏差。

  2. 统计分析:运用统计学方法,对数据进行描述性统计、推断性统计和假设检验,识别数据偏差。

  3. 数据挖掘:利用数据挖掘技术,挖掘数据中的潜在规律和异常值,识别数据偏差。

  4. 机器学习:通过机器学习算法,对数据进行训练和预测,识别数据偏差。

四、案例分析

某电商企业在其销售系统中发现,部分订单数据存在重复现象。经过调查,发现重复订单是由于订单录入人员操作失误导致的。企业通过以下措施解决数据偏差问题:

  1. 优化订单录入流程,减少操作失误。

  2. 加强员工培训,提高数据录入质量。

  3. 建立数据监控机制,实时监控订单数据质量。

通过以上措施,企业有效解决了订单数据偏差问题,提高了数据质量。

总之,在全链路数据质量监控中,识别数据偏差是确保数据准确性和可靠性的关键。通过数据可视化、统计分析、数据挖掘和机器学习等方法,可以有效识别数据偏差。同时,企业应建立完善的数据监控机制,及时发现并处理数据偏差,提高数据质量。

猜你喜欢:微服务监控